**PLEASE NOTE** This is an Award Notice and the opportunity is now closed. The City of London Corporation (the ‘City) undertook a 1 stage procurement process in relation to Universal Youth and Play Services (the 'Service'). The Service will commission youth work and play activities from an external organisation, which will adhere to the youth work and play principles and will raise the aspirations of children and young people aged 8-19, with an emphasis of working with children and young people aged between 8-12 and 13-19 year olds The Service will also support young people aged up to 25 with learning difficulties and or disabilities, or are a care leaver to achieve their potential. Total Quantity or Scope

The Service is classified under Schedule 3 of the Public Contracts Regulations 2015 as “Provision of services to the community”. Therefore, the Service advertised i.e. this contract notice, fall among those listed in Annex XIV to Directive 2014/24/EU and the full obligations set out in that directive do not apply. For the avoidance of doubt, the contract was procured in accordance with the Public Contracts Regulations 2015 Regulations 74 to 78, more commonly known as the Light Touch Regime. The procurement was run as a one stage process, resembling the open procedure and its main features - which includes the core elements of the standard Selection Questionnaire (SQ). Any organisation that considers itself able to meet the requirements of the selection criteria within the Qualification Envelope was invited to submit a tender. The requirements of the Service are set out in the procurement documents, particularly the Service Specification - available from: https://www.capitalesourcing.com The City of London Corporation are redesigning the delivery of services to support young people living in the City aged between 8-19 years of age (and up to 25 for young people Leaving Care and young people with disabilities). The main outcomes of the Service are: • Increased engagement in inclusive provision that raises the aspirations and supports the development of young people between 8-19 years of age. This will enable all young people to access and engage in activities that develop their confidence and build their self-esteem. • Reduce health inequalities, improve and maintain good physical and mental health. Ensuring that young people are informed and supported to make safe and healthy choices, and are referred to appropriate services when additional support is required. • Ensuring young people feel safe in their communities and develop positive relationships. • Partnership working with the City and other providers. • Ensuring the commissioned services provide added value to the community, and support the social value act. • Outcomes for young people demonstrated through performance data. The duration of the contract is two (2) years, with the option to extend up to two (2) further years in annual increments. The Contract is intended to commence 1st April 2022 to 31st March 2024.
